Mbbs course is very vast, so our curriculum focus on all aspects of students, sports, events, and all for overall development of a student.we have 3 internal exams and 1 main final MN exam in each year.

After course of 4 yr of graduation there is compulsory internship of 1 year. After that we are posted in different area of our state to serve the people.every students get salary for this. Our job is secure after we get into the college.

Fee Structure And Facilities

Feasible our college is govt. college so no worry about fees, a poor person can afford to make their child to study. We pay 40000 per year, including hostel fee. Mess fee is 3000 per month.rest no problem for fee.

Fees and Financial Aid

As our fee is very less then any other colleges, so college don't provide any scholarship. But our state govt. And central govt provides many other scholarship to those student who really need it.i have not availed anything till date.

Admission

There is a all india level entrance exam, then all india ranks are allotes to student according to their merit. Then counselling Process is done for documents verification and college allotment.after that college is given to student

Placement Experience:

1.You do not have to worry about placement after pursuing MBBS from VIMSAR. there are many vacancies available in state and all over india. 2.after completing 4.5 years of MBBS you have to do a mandatory paid inernship of Rs.42075 then after you will gt the degree to be eligible to fill vacancies for various govt. jobs 3.During internship period you will get an amount of Rs. 42075 (with paid holidays) which is higest paid internship in whole india. 4. nearly every student get a descent job as a doctor, many opt to take drop and prepare for NEET PG examination. 5.I may practise as a government doctor in hospital or take drop to study for NEET PG examination

Admission:

I got admission in this course by applying in NEET entrance examination. I got good score in my NEET entrance exam and cleared the cutoff set by the college. I got this college in my NEET counselling based on my NEET score. I got this college under all India quota. Candidate who wishes to take admission in this course must appear for NEET entrance examination and must have a valid NEET score. A candidate must at least have 50% in 10+2 in physics, chemistry and biology. After having good NEET score I applied for counseling and in that I got this college.
